Robin Greer
Robin Greer, born on May 27, 1960, in Hollywood, California, is a distinguished actress celebrated for her contributions to television and film. She gained recognition for her role in the popular soap opera "Falcon Crest," which aired in 1981 and showcased her talent in a dramatic setting. Greer's versatility is evident in her appearances on the iconic sci-fi series "Quantum Leap" in 1989, where she captivated audiences with her engaging performances.
Prior to these notable roles, she showcased her skills in the 1979 film "Angels' Brigade," further solidifying her place in the entertainment industry.
